Around two months ago I somehow ended up purchasing a pitiful looking sighthound for the grand sum of £60. She was very underweight. Took her to the vets first off and they were shocked at her lack of muscle. Only a year old or so but it was obvious she had just been locked away in a conservatory or similar with no exercise.

I took her out into an enclosed area just to see how she would behave off lead. She tried to sprint but the lack of muscle meant she just fell over on the corners. She did one lap then collapsed exhausted because of her lack of fitness. Straight back on the lead for the next six weeks, walking each day but with absolutely no off lead work again until her muscle was built up enough to manage without injury.

Her first times on a lead were eventful. She hadn't a clue. She dragged me everywhere. Bouncing around like a kangaroo. Everything was fascinating.

Because we go on the forest everyday all my dogs are expected to get straight in the shower afterwards to wash them down. The poor girl was petrified. I had to lift her in and she would just shake and try to lay down.

So two months on and she's a different dog. She's up to weight with ever improving muscle tone. She walks quietly on a lead. I let her off for a sprint each day and she can motorbike round like a pro. The best bit is that I now don't even have to tell her to get in the shower, she walks herself straight in :)

We still have a way to go but I'm dead chuffed with the progress already made.
